Eight Michigan rural communities get USDA loans and grants to fix water infrastructure problems
Small communities have the same problems as bigger ones with their water infrastructure - aging equipment and stormwater and sewage mains, leaking private septic systems, and rainwater ditches overwhelmed by heavier rains due to climate change. Eight Michigan rural communities will get USDA help fixing some of those issues.

Flint officials say paperwork, weather explain missed property restoration deadline
Paperwork and winter weather apparently prevented the city of Flint from meeting a deadline for a report on restoring property damaged by the city’s lead pipe replacement projects.

EPA implements first-ever PFAS drinking water standards
The Environmental Protection Agency is implementing the first-ever drinking water standards on six PFAS substances.
